Because Portugal, playing tonight against Congo, will play the World Cup with one more man

On the wrist of Cristiano Ronaldo and his teammates this evening there will be a bracelet engraved with the name of the late Diogo Jota, who died in a car accident on the night between 2 and 3 July 2025. A tragedy that has marked Portuguese football and fans around the world

A gift from the prime minister, with everyone’s names

Vitinha explained the history of the accessory during the press conference on June 14th. The bracelet is a gift from Prime Minister Luís Montenegro, who met the team in the United States and made sure that it could be worn on the pitch: no small detail, because an object on the wrist, during an official match, must comply with precise regulatory parameters. It was precisely the Prime Minister’s intervention that obtained the bureaucratic green light to wear it during matches.

The emptiness of July 3rd

To understand the weight of the gesture we need to go back to last summer. On 3 July 2025 Diogo Jota lost his life in a car accident in Spain, together with his brother André Silva; he was 28 years old. The Liverpool striker had just returned from perhaps the best months of his life (he had just married his longtime partner) and was a pillar of the national team. With Portugal he had made 49 appearances and 14 goals, leaving his mark both on the pitch and in the dressing room.

The match that isn’t like the others

The debut with Congo, in this sense, brings with it a meaning that goes beyond the result. It is Portugal’s first match in a World Cup since Jota’s death, and coach Roberto Martínez, in the preparation phase, has repeatedly recalled its human value even before its sporting value. The bracelet, moreover, will accompany the national team for the entire American adventure, not just for one evening. So, while the odds all lean towards the Lusitanians, the real news of the day lies in an object of just a few grams. Eleven on the pitch, plus a name engraved on the wrist of each one: Portugal will play with twelve men this evening.
